Join our dynamic service team for this entry level field service
position. Depending on your assigned territory, you will
provide services, repairs and technical maintenance for ATM's,
retail point of sale (POS) equipment, locksmithing,
Electric Vehicle Charging (EVC) plus related PC and PC peripherals
on customer premises. Our training consists of on the-job mentoring
as you might expect, but also formal classroom, virtual and
self-paced training for extensive learning opportunities.
You are responsible for:
Performing maintenance on ATMs (e.g., card reader, printer, reset
and test devices, etc.). Electromechanical repair.
Performing basic installation functions (e.g., set up and test
equipment, pulling cables, mounting devices, installing
locks).
Performing technical fixes such as clearing paper jams, card jams,
bill jams, etc.
Inspecting products for correct operation and resolving noted
issues and/or escalating according to established procedures.
Prioritizing and planning service calls.
Works within a team environment, completes all required paperwork,
manages, and maintains service parts inventory.
Contacting the customer with the estimated time of arrival.
Working with customers to ensure satisfaction with service delivery
and understanding of product functionality.
Following key/alarm/combination control processes in assigned area
of responsibility.
